在当前数据驱动的时代,报表的可视化与交互性显得尤为重要。作为一款功能丰富的智能报表系统,FineReport 提供了多种交互控件,其中下拉复选框是一个极为实用的选项。下拉复选框可以使用户在选择时更加灵活,能够在多个选项中自由选择,从而提高数据分析的效率。本文将详细介绍在 FineReport 中如何制作下拉复选框,帮助用户更好地利用该工具。
1. 理解下拉复选框的基本概念
下拉复选框是一种在界面中呈现多个选项的控件,用户可以通过点击下拉框来选择自己需要的选项。其与传统的单选框不同,用户可以选择多个选项。这种控件在很多场景下都会受到欢迎,如订单筛选、数据分析等。
使用下拉复选框的好处在于,它可以显著压缩界面空间,避免信息的过度拥挤,提高用户体验。而且,用户的选择结果可以直接反映到报表中,使得报表的动态性和互动性大大增强。
2. 在 FineReport 中添加下拉复选框
在 FineReport 中添加下拉复选框的步骤相对简单。首先,用户需要登录到 FineReport 后台管理系统,进入到报表设计界面。
2.1 打开报表设计器
在 FineReport 的操作界面中,选择需要添加下拉复选框的报表并打开其设计器。可以看到工具栏中有多个功能按钮。
2.2 插入形状
在工具栏中找到“插入”选项,并选择“控件”下的“下拉复选框”。此时光标会变成一个十字形,用户可以在报表中任意位置点击左键来插入下拉复选框。
2.3 配置下拉复选框
插入完成后,会弹出下拉复选框的属性配置窗口。在这里,用户需要设置下拉复选框的数据源,可以选择从数据库中提取选项,也可以手动输入选项内容。
2.4 调整样式
为了达到更美观的视觉效果,用户可以在属性设置中调整下拉复选框的样式,例如边框颜色、字体样式等。同时,在设计器中也支持调整控件的大小和位置,让报表整体看起来更加协调。
3. 调用下拉复选框的选择结果
下拉复选框不仅仅是添加后的静态控件,其选择结果可以影响报表的数据显示。为了有效地调用下拉复选框的选择结果,用户需要进行以下配置。
3.1 关联数据
在下拉复选框的属性中,设置对应的值与报表的数据源进行关联。用户可以通过“值类型”选择不同的数据类型,例如文本型或者数值型,以确保选择结果能够在报表中正确显示。
3.2 编写计算公式
在报表的相应单元格中,可以使用**公式**来引用下拉复选框的选择值,从而实现数据的动态更新。例如,可以使用“IF”语句来判断用户选择的不同选项,从而返回不同的数值或文本。
3.3 生成动态报表
通过设置下拉复选框的选项和关联逻辑,用户可以生成一个可以实时更新的动态报表。当用户在下拉复选框中选择不同的选项时,报表将会立即反映出相应的数据变化,提高了分析的灵活性和实用性。
4. 实际案例分析
为了更好地理解下拉复选框的应用,以下是一个实际的案例分析。例如,在销售报表中,用户希望按不同的产品类别进行数据分析。
4.1 设置产品类别
首先,用户在下拉复选框中输入不同的产品类别,如“电子产品”、“家居用品”、“服装”等,这些将会作为用户筛选的选项。
4.2 关联销售数据
接下来,用户将这些类别与销售数据进行关联。若用户选择了“电子产品”,那么报表中显示的将是电子产品的销售额。这种动态数据能够让管理层快速做出决策。
4.3 优化报表布局
最后,用户还可以根据自己的需求,调整报表的布局,使得下拉复选框与数据呈现更加协调,以提升用户体验。
5. 总结与展望
下拉复选框作为 FineReport 中的一项重要交互控件,将极大地增强报表的可用性与灵活性。通过合理的设置与应用,它不仅能够提升用户的操作体验,还能在数据分析和决策支持中发挥重要作用。随着技术的不断发展,未来的报表设计将更加智能化、自动化,为企业提供更为强大的数据支持。
总之,掌握下拉复选框的制作方法,能够帮助用户更好地运用 FineReport 进行数据可视化,实现更高效的信息呈现。希望本文的讲解对您在使用 FineReport 的过程中有所帮助。